DEVELOPMENT
IN FIRE-RATED
PRODUCTS
» » ONCE AGAIN RAISING THE
bar and extending its range of durable,
dependable fire-rated products, pioneering
Astraseal has become the first fabricator
to manufacture a 60-minute rated, fixed fire
window.
Instead of traditional hardwood or steel,
Astraseal’s unique fire window system
is based on the proven FireFrame from
Winkhaus, combining durable composite
and PVCu materials for advanced fire
resistance. Add to this Astraseal’s fire-
retardant sealed units and the new window
system can provide a long-lasting barrier
for both internal and external uses.
The new fire window system is available
in a range of sizes in both single and double
fixed pane configurations. Designed for use
in any residential or commercial application,
the window offers incredibly slim, internal
sightlines along with dependable durability
and strength thanks to its, innovative hybrid
frame.
The 60-minute fire window strengthens
Astraseal’s industry-leading fire-rated
product line, joining its range of PVCu
and composite FD30 and FD60 fire door
systems. As well as offering its brand-new
60-minute solution, Astraseal also offers
the RAUFERNO PVCu fire-window system.
Based on REHAU’s Total 70 profile and the
popular S706 window, the RAUFERNO is a
high-performance 30-minute alternative.

COMPOSITE DOORS
CONTINUE TO PERFORM
» » A NEW REPORT FROM PALMER
Market Research suggests the composite
door sector will see significant growth
through to 2021.
According to The Market for
Domestic Entrance Doors, composite
doors now account for 54% of the
market, the share rising to 56% by
installed value with the inclusion of
PVCu/ABS faced doors.
This follows an above market forecast, 9%
increase in volume last year to 758,000 doors.
This contributed to 7.9% increase in
installed value for the total entrance door
market, the move to composites from PVCu
panels inflating installed prices.
Taken in its entirety, the market for
entrance doors, however, remained relatively
flat last year at 1.4million door sets, with
growth of just 0.9%. This compares to the
2.2% seen last year.
Despite the growth of composites, PVCu
panels remained the second biggest material,
accounting for 25% of the
market in volume terms and
24% in installed value. This included
modest growth in volume last year of 0.7%
to 351,000 door sets.
Timber accounted for 16% in volume and
15% in installed value. This included a 25%
decline in volume to 228,000 doors .
Steel faced door sets fell 12% in 2016 to
40,000 doors – supplied almost exclusively
into new build.
